(this message is in french, english and german, so everyone can respond !)

Hi everyone !
I\\\'ve troubleshooting with the building of a dedicated server.
In fact, the server just runs as it has to do, but he is not joinable by other players.
His status in server browser is \\\"waiting for response\\\".
On my firewall (Iptable) I saied to transfer incoming connection to port 28785 (UDP) and 28786 (UDP) to my server.

I don\\\'t understand why it\\\'s not working correctly. (I can join the game from LAN)

you should find a lot of posts about this already on the forum, the search function is your friend - use your browsers page-search to home in on the morsels ;-)
I have repeatedly heard that http://portforward.com/ is supposed to be rather helpful in these cases.

are you registering with the masterserver?
what is it's response if you try to?

since it's working on LAN you should be able to connect as long as packets are correctly routed (keywords : DNAT, port forwarding, DMZ).

Can a remote client manually connect (via "/connect IP-4-SERVER")?

by Greywhind on 01/03/2007 19:03

I believe the point was that you can't possibly have high ping to your own server. Your ping will be 0, since you will be connecting to localhost. Thus, he probably meant "a slow internet connection" and not "high ping."

reply to this message

#16: Re: ..

by Passa on 01/04/2007 12:39, refers to #15

Of course, assuming the server is run on the PC he uses with Sauer. Heh, I get 100 ping on my server, stupid wireless is working somewhat at the moment so I'm not going to touch it :/

Anyway, you'll find even DIALUP will host 2-3 players at playable speeds with Sauer. Standard ADSL is not much better than dialup for hosting, as its upload aint much better. The lowest end ADSL (256k/64k) with 64k upload could probably host 4 players without any problems (of course that would be sacrificing all of your upstream bandwidth), 128k upload would probably be preferable for 4 players though.

Gotta clear up the cable argument too.. 4 players max really, I've seen some cable 6 player servers and the lag can get real ugly.. and before you cablers mention how you download at 1 meg a second, remember that cable has an upload of 128k..
